]> git.lizzy.rs Git - rust.git/blob - src/test/rustdoc/intra-doc/non-path-primitives.rs
rustdoc: link to stable/beta docs consistently in documentation
[rust.git] / src / test / rustdoc / intra-doc / non-path-primitives.rs
1 #![crate_name = "foo"]
2 #![feature(intra_doc_pointers)]
3 #![deny(rustdoc::broken_intra_doc_links)]
4
5 // @has foo/index.html '//a[@href="{{channel}}/std/primitive.slice.html#method.rotate_left"]' 'slice::rotate_left'
6 //! [slice::rotate_left]
7
8 // @has - '//a[@href="{{channel}}/std/primitive.array.html#method.map"]' 'array::map'
9 //! [array::map]
10
11 // @has - '//a[@href="{{channel}}/std/primitive.str.html"]' 'owned str'
12 // @has - '//a[@href="{{channel}}/std/primitive.str.html"]' 'str ref'
13 // @has - '//a[@href="{{channel}}/std/primitive.str.html#method.is_empty"]' 'str::is_empty'
14 // @has - '//a[@href="{{channel}}/std/primitive.str.html#method.len"]' '&str::len'
15 //! [owned str][str]
16 //! [str ref][&str]
17 //! [str::is_empty]
18 //! [&str::len]
19
20 // @has - '//a[@href="{{channel}}/std/primitive.pointer.html#method.is_null"]' 'pointer::is_null'
21 // @has - '//a[@href="{{channel}}/std/primitive.pointer.html#method.is_null"]' '*const::is_null'
22 // @has - '//a[@href="{{channel}}/std/primitive.pointer.html#method.is_null"]' '*mut::is_null'
23 //! [pointer::is_null]
24 //! [*const::is_null]
25 //! [*mut::is_null]
26
27 // @has - '//a[@href="{{channel}}/std/primitive.unit.html"]' 'unit'
28 //! [unit]
29
30 // @has - '//a[@href="{{channel}}/std/primitive.tuple.html"]' 'tuple'
31 //! [tuple]
32
33 // @has - '//a[@href="{{channel}}/std/primitive.reference.html"]' 'reference'
34 // @has - '//a[@href="{{channel}}/std/primitive.reference.html"]' '&'
35 // @has - '//a[@href="{{channel}}/std/primitive.reference.html"]' '&mut'
36 //! [reference]
37 //! [&]
38 //! [&mut]
39
40 // @has - '//a[@href="{{channel}}/std/primitive.fn.html"]' 'fn'
41 //! [fn]
42
43 // @has - '//a[@href="{{channel}}/std/primitive.never.html"]' 'never'
44 // @has - '//a[@href="{{channel}}/std/primitive.never.html"]' '!'
45 //! [never]
46 //! [!]